    Once you get the bumper and grill off, it’s pretty self explanatory. Remove the plastic from the aluminum crash bar and the aluminum crash bar itself. The hitch takes place of the two aluminum spacers that the bar is bolted to and then the bar bolts to the hitch. The bumper grill will have to be trimmed accordingly to fit back over the hitch. At least on my 2011. 2012 may be a different in how it lines up. I put mine on my 2011 Taco and then modified it to go on my 2017.

    I cant find anymore of the info on my computer at work and the PDF file is gone or I'm crazy and never had one. It's a pretty easy install if you've got some mechanical experience. Measure 2,3,4x before doing any trimming of the bumper or grill to fit around the hitch if you want it to look nice. I've been super happy with mine and I use it a lot in the winter months winching myself and the buddies out in the snow. If you use it as it's intended, slowly with a winch and not as a tow bar at 60mph in reverse, it will do you well! Good luck with the install.
